Що таке Arduino і що з цим можна зробити?

Що таке Arduino і що з цим можна зробити?

Якщо ви чимось схожі на мене, то возитися з електронікою - це те, що ви дійсно хотіли б зробити - принаймні, в теорії. Насправді, тимчасові обмеження і брак знань неминуче заважають вам спробувати. Це занадто складно. Вам подобається розбирати розбиті гаджети, але ніколи не робити нічого зі знайденими битами, крім як заховати їх під дощовий день (ящик, повний мікрохвильових деталей? Перевірте).

Arduino є відповіддю на все це, і, чесно кажучи, все, що можна вважати кумедним під час навчання, є, на мою думку, дійсно революційним пристроєм.


Технічно Arduino - це програмований логічний контролер. Офіційно це платформа для створення прототипів електроніки з відкритим вихідним кодом - але що це означає?

Для вас або для мене це як маленький комп'ютер, який ви можете програмувати, і він взаємодіє зі світом за допомогою електронних датчиків, джерел світла і двигунів. По суті, це робить деякі по-справжньому хардкорні проекти в області електроніки доступними для всіх, тому художники і творчі люди можуть зосередитися на втіленні своїх ідей у життя. Це ідеальний інструмент для мастерингу!

Цитувати:

Arduino - це платформа для створення прототипів електроніки з відкритим вихідним кодом, заснована на гнучкому, простому у використанні апаратному та програмному забезпеченні. Він призначений для художників, дизайнерів, любителів і всіх, хто цікавиться створенням інтерактивних об'єктів або середовищ.

Що ти можеш зробити з цим?

Перш ніж обговорювати, що робить Arduino таким революційним пристроєм, я думаю, що краще показати вам деякі з моїх улюблених проектів, які були зроблені з Arduino.

1. 3D-принтери

У минулому ми показували вам MakerBot, які, 3D-принтер. Ну, це використовує пару Arduinos для управління такими речами, як виштовхування розплавленого пластику з друкуючої головки для переміщення платформи.


2. Puff Чарівний дракон Бойовий Робот

Звичайно, всілякі роботи є головними кандидатами на створення з Arduino, але цей самий симпатичний, який я коли-небудь бачив. Використовуючи базову раму робота, 2 мотори і 2 датчики світла, цей маленький хлопець може знайти джерело тепла, попрямувати до нього і погасити вогонь - все автономно.

(* Автономне значення, воно робить це самостійно, без контролю людини).

Якщо цей проект вас цікавить, подивіться, як Xod може допомогти вам створити робота Arduino.

3. Лазерна Арфа

Приголомшливі звуки трансу, лазери, що ще можна побажати?

4. Бейкер Чирикать

Простий спосіб повідомити покупцям, що приготовлений свіжий хліб, BakerTweet має набір для вибору хліба і кнопку твіту! Я думаю, ви погодитеся, що це найунікальніше використання Arduino.

5. світлодіодні кубики

Найкращий спосіб пояснити це - просто подивитися відео - це просто чудово; 8x8x8 світлодіодний куб (це 512 світлодіодів), все управління здійснюється Arduino.

Рівень складності знаходиться на більш високому боці, хоча. Не хвилюйтеся, якщо це здається складним - у нас є повний світлодіодний куб Arduino підручник, який охоплює все, що вам потрібно знати.


Так весело і гри осторонь, що саме робить Arduino таким особливим? Звичайно, є й інші контролери, що програмуються?

Відкрите джерело

Arduino - це торгова марка, але велика частина розробленого ними апаратного і програмного забезпечення має відкритий вихідний код. Схеми доступні в Інтернеті, тому, якщо ви не хочете купувати готовий Arduino, ви можете безкоштовно купити окремі компоненти і зробити їх самостійно або купити один з безлічі доступних клонованих пристроїв. На цьому етапі варто подумати, чи варто взагалі використовувати офіційну плату Arduino!

зв'язок

Як частина апаратного забезпечення, Arduino може працювати незалежно (як у роботі), підключатися до комп'ютера (тим самим надаючи вашому комп'ютеру доступ до даних датчиків із зовнішнього світу і забезпечуючи зворотний зв'язок), або з'єднуватися до інших Arduino або інших електронних пристроїв. пристрої і контролери чіпів. Практично все може бути пов'язано і обмежено тільки вашою уявою, готовністю витратити деякий час і зусилля на вивчення чогось нового і доступність компонентів. Якщо ви можете думати про це - Arduino може зробити це.

Багатство підтримки

Є тисячі інших людей і організацій, що приймають Arduino. Результатом цього є те, що, якщо вам не вистачає у відділі творчості, завжди є заздалегідь запрограмований проект для вас, і завжди є щось нове для вивчення. Це також дуже легко почати.

Універсальність і вартість

Офіційна повна плата Uno коштує 25 доларів, а клон Uno всього 4 долари, що робить ці маленькі електронні чудеса доступними як для любителів, так і для освітніх установ.


Мова програмування, яку ви завантажуєте, неймовірно проста і повинна бути знаком будь-кому, хто мав досвід роботи з Java або подібними мовами. (Це насправді ґрунтується на обробці).

Це також фантастичний інструмент навчання, за допомогою якого ви можете експериментувати з електронікою і вивчати основи. Насправді, якби ми мали їх, коли я був у школі, я майже впевнений, що став би інженером з апаратного забезпечення.

Безліч варіантів

Після випуску Arduino багато інших компаній прийняли апаратний принцип відкритого вихідного коду. Поряд з багатьма клонованими платами, що з'явилися на ринку, доступно кілька унікальних дизайнів, які сумісні з Arduino IDE. Ці плати беруть загальний дух оригінальних плат Arduino і додають додаткові функції.

Яскравим прикладом є NodeMCU дошка для розробки. Ця плата, яка також крихітна, має вбудований Wi-Fi і, крім того, сумісна з Arduino, може використовуватися в якості крихітного Node.Js. сервер. Доступні всього за 3 долари, ці крихітні плати настільки хороші, що ми подумали, чи стануть вони прямим конкурентом трону Arduino.

Одним з наших улюблених мікроконтролерів тут, на, є лінійка плат Teensy. Ці невеликі плати володіють набагато більшою продуктивністю, ніж плати Arduino, з крихітним форм-фактором, що робить їх ідеальними для невеликих проектів, в основі яких лежить потужна обробка.


Все ще хочете дізнатися більше? Подивіться цей короткий документальний фільм про Arduino, який трохи більше розкриває фон і мотиви проекту. Велика частина написана італійською мовою, тому що, якщо назва ще не видана, проект почався в Італії.

Отримати створення

Arduino повністю змінили захоплення електронікою. Те, що було неможливо без великих знань в минулому, тепер досяжне всіма завдяки широкому асортименту доступних дешевих мікроконтролерів і величезній спільноті, що оточує його.

Почати теж досить легко, і у нас є зручне керівництво для початківців щоб вивести вас з ладу. Або подивіться наш проект: Управління світлофорами підручник.

Ви тільки починаєте в світі мікроконтролерів? Яку дошку ви збираєтеся отримати? Що ви плануєте зробити? Дайте нам знати в розділі коментарів нижче!

Image

Publish modules to the "offcanvas" position.